One-step Method of Producing Uniaxially Oriented Layers of Organic Discotic Molecules for Field-Effect Transistors

P. MISKIEWICZ, A. RYBAK, J. JUNG, I. GLOWACKI, W. MANIUKIEWICZ, A. TRACZ, J. PFLEGER, J. ULANSKI AND K. MULLEN

Highly oriented layers of organic semiconductors: hexa-benzocoronene (p-type) andperylene derivative (n-type) were obtained by the zone-casting technique - a one step method of producing highly aligned layers of solution processible organic materials with no need of use of any preoriented surface. Orientation was confirmed by X-ray diffraction, optical and atomic force microscopy observations and charge carrier transport anisotropy. First field effect transistor based on the zone-cast layer is presented.
